If you start X with:-

startx -- -logverbose=5

The log should then give you a detailed list of all the modelines the LCD
supports and their names. In my case it's as simple as:-

Modeline "1920x1080_100i" "1280x720_50" "720x576"

This gives me all 3 'HD' modes.

Mark

(P.S. you might find the latest nvidia drivers reject certain modelines that
are perfectly valid. In that case tinker with the 'ModeValidation' options
in your xorg.conf)
